Highlights

On average, there are 155 sunny days per year in Ithaca. Castle Rock averages 243 sunny days per year. The US average is 205 sunny days.

Ithaca, New York gets 37.4 inches of rain, on average, per year. Castle Rock, Colorado gets 18.6 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38.1 inches of rain per year.

Ithaca averages 63.3 inches of snow per year. Castle Rock averages 78.3 inches of snow per year. The US average is 27.8 inches of snow per year.

July is the hottest month for Castle Rock with an average high temperature of 85.5°, which ranks it as about average compared to other places in Colorado. In Castle Rock, there are 3 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Castle Rock are June, September and August.

July is the hottest month for Ithaca with an average high temperature of 80.9°, which ranks it as cooler than most places in New York. In Ithaca, there are 4 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Ithaca are June, August and July.
December has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Castle Rock with an average of 18.1°. This is one of the warmest places in Colorado.

January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Ithaca with an average of 14.7°. This is colder than most places in New York.

In Castle Rock, there are 14.9 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is cooler than most places in Colorado.

In Ithaca, there are 5.1 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is about average compared to other places in New York.

In Castle Rock, there are 156.4 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is warmer than most places in Colorado.

In Ithaca, there are 145.8 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is colder than most places in New York.

In Castle Rock, there are 5.6 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is warmer than most places in Colorado.

In Ithaca, there are 9.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is colder than most places in New York.

August is the wettest month in Castle Rock with 2.6 inches of rain, and the driest month is January with 0.6 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 40% of yearly precipitation and 10% occurs in Spring,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 18.6 inches in Castle Rock means that it is wetter than most places in Colorado.


June is the wettest month in Ithaca with 4.0 inches of rain, and the driest month is February with 1.9 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 30% of yearly precipitation and 17% occurs in Spring,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 37.4 inches in Ithaca means that it is drier than most places in New York.

August is the rainiest month in Castle Rock with 9.9 days of rain, and January is the driest month with only 3.3 rainy days. There are 70.0 rainy days annually in Castle Rock, which is less rainy than most places in Colorado. The rainiest season is Autumn when it rains 37% of the time and the driest is Spring with only a 15% chance of a rainy day.

January is the rainiest month in Ithaca with 15.2 days of rain, and August is the driest month with only 11.5 rainy days. There are 159.3 rainy days annually in Ithaca, which is rainier than most places in New York.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 26% of the time and the driest is Autumn with only a 24% chance of a rainy day.

An annual snowfall of 78.3 inches in Castle Rock means that it is snowier than most places in Colorado.

An annual snowfall of 63.3 inches in Ithaca means that it is snowier than most places in New York.
March is the snowiest month in Castle Rock with 16.8 inches of snow, and 9 months of the year have significant snowfall.

January is the snowiest month in Ithaca with 16.7 inches of snow, and 6 months of the year have significant snowfall.

Many people confuse Weather and Climate, but they are different. Weather ref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, while Climate ref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a long period of time.

Weather, more specifically, refers to how the atmosphere behaves and its effects on life and human activities. Most people think of Weather in terms of what can be observed: temperature, humidity, precipitation, and cloudy/sunny conditions. Weather conditions constantly change on a minute-to-minute basis.

Climate is a record of the average weather conditions for a given place over a long period of time, often referred to as Climate Normals. A 30-year period of record is a common requirement to be considered a Climate Normal.
